Database design 卡桑德拉适合银行应用吗?
各位开发人员,您好,我有一个关于Cassandra的非常令人不安的问题,Cassandra是否适合保存敏感数据的银行应用程序 因为卡桑德拉不是用酸而是用盖帽,怎么样 这是在Cassandra中实现良好和安全数据库的策略吗?感谢您的回复,并对我的英语不好表示歉意Database design 卡桑德拉适合银行应用吗?,database-design,cassandra,banking,onlinebanking,Database Design,Cassandra,Banking,Onlinebanking,各位开发人员,您好,我有一个关于Cassandra的非常令人不安的问题,Cassandra是否适合保存敏感数据的银行应用程序 因为卡桑德拉不是用酸而是用盖帽,怎么样 这是在Cassandra中实现良好和安全数据库的策略吗?感谢您的回复,并对我的英语不好表示歉意 :D银行业是一个广泛的行业,有许多不同种类的系统,可以被视为“银行应用程序”。卡桑德拉在某些方面可能是合适的 然而,缺乏ACID支持可能会排除金融交易系统 “如果我储存一些东西怎么样 像信用卡一样敏感 信息,还是事务性的 信息,CAP仍
:D银行业是一个广泛的行业,有许多不同种类的系统,可以被视为“银行应用程序”。卡桑德拉在某些方面可能是合适的 然而,缺乏ACID支持可能会排除金融交易系统
“如果我储存一些东西怎么样 像信用卡一样敏感 信息,还是事务性的 信息,CAP仍然安全吗 不使用酸“ 这是两种不同的保险箱 对于信用卡信息,安全意味着防止未经授权访问数据。这不仅包括文件系统上的存储,还包括节点间通信。我相信Cassandra的最新版本确实支持这一点,但我认为您的应用程序最好对信用卡详细信息进行加密/解密,并让Cassandra存储GobbleDeBook
对于事务性信息,安全性意味着数据的一致视图,而不管访问路径如何。当我们处理银行余额时,最终的一致性是不好的。另一方面,Cassandra可以在审计跟踪中记录事务细节 这就好比问java是否适合银行业。银行似乎是一套非常传统的应用程序,依赖于在关系表中轻松(高效)存储和操作的数据——基本客户数据、分类账等等。在我看来,这将是一个典型的例子,说明什么时候不使用那些“NoSQL”数据库…@Oded我想他是在问敏感数据的安全问题。因此,它更像是“MySql是否足以在涉及大量法规遵从性问题的情况下存储敏感数据”。这是一个非常有效的问题。如果我存储一些敏感信息,如信用卡信息或交易信息,CAP是否仍然安全,因为不使用ACID?谢谢您的回答Hei APC,谢谢你提供的信息,这对我很有帮助,也让我明白了这类问题,这就是我真正的意思